site stats

Max heapify in c

Web4 mrt. 2024 · C Programming Searching and Sorting Algorithm: Exercise-5 with Solution Write a C program to sort numbers using the MAX heap algorithm. Note: A sorting … Web// Max-Heap data structure in C #include int size = 0; void swap (int *a, int *b) { int temp = *b; *b = *a; *a = temp; } void heapify (int array [], int size, int i) { if (size == 1) { printf ("Single …

Answered: 6.4-1 Using Figure 6.4 as a model,… bartleby

Web17 jan. 2024 · C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App Development with Kotlin(Live) Python Backend Development with Django(Live) Machine Learning and Data Science. Complete Data Science Program(Live) Mastering Data … Web31 mei 2024 · Extract the max value from the heap (root) and put it in a new array. Replace the last element of the array with root (index=0) and remove it from the array. Try to build … i have an apple phone https://boytekhali.com

Max Heap Data Structure Implementation in Java DigitalOcean

Web1 dag geleden · Source code: Lib/heapq.py. This module provides an implementation of the heap queue algorithm, also known as the priority queue algorithm. Heaps are binary … Webheapq库中的函数的时间复杂度是多少?[英] What's the time complexity of functions in heapq library Web8 okt. 2014 · This program will sort your tree for max heap . First of all it will take input(The size of the Heap) then according to your given size this program will take input the … i have an apple tv box how does it work

用C语言编写先来先服务算法 - CSDN文库

Category:Heap Sort - javatpoint

Tags:Max heapify in c

Max heapify in c

Heap Data Structure - Programiz

WebA 4-ary max heap is like a binary max heap, but instead of 2 children, nodes have 4 children. A 4-ary heap can be represented by an array as shown in Figure (up to level 2). … Web17 mrt. 2024 · MAX HEAP heapify in C language Ask Question Asked 5 years ago Modified 5 years ago Viewed 473 times 0 The problem is that my heapify func only heapifies …

Max heapify in c

Did you know?

Web5 nov. 2024 · This is program for max heapify ,i have doubt int this algorithm,that if a already max heap is passed into this function MAX_HEAPIFY in that case largest will equal to i … Web6 apr. 2024 · Replace it with the last item of the heap followed by reducing the size of heap by 1. Finally, heapify the root of tree. Repeat above steps while size of heap is greater than 1. Note: Heap Sort using min heap sorts in descending order where as max heap sorts in ascending order Implementation: C++ Java Python3 C# Javascript #include

Web6 mei 2024 · Heapq Functions. Assuming that you know how the heap data structure works, let’s see what functions are provided by Python’s heapq model. heappush (heap, item) — Push the value item into the heap. heappop (heap) — Pop and return the smallest value from the heap. heappushpop (heap, item) — Push the value item into the heap and … WebThis C++ program, displays the maximum heap in which each node of a binary tree is greater than or equal to it’s child nodes. Here is the source code of the C++ program …

Web11 apr. 2024 · In step 3, calling max_heapify(Arr, 1) , (node indexed with 1 has value 1 ), 1 is swapped with 10 . Step 4 is a subpart of step 3, as after swapping 1 with 10, again a … Web9 apr. 2024 · Split it into separate functions. ReadInput and Heapify; To improve code readability, index operation like theheap[(j - 1) / 2] or index = (2 * j + 1) can be …

Web23 aug. 2024 · A max heap is a data structure in which each child node is less than or equal to its parent node. A min heap is a similar type of data structure where each child node is …

Web21 apr. 2024 · Max Heap : Parent node value is greater than child node value. Example of min and max heap in pictorial representation. Why do we need Binary Heap? Let us consider array data structure as an example. When we want to insert an element inside the sorted array, we need to find "Min/Max" element and insert in a proper position. is the iphone se supportedWeb2 aug. 2013 · Build Max-Heap: Using MAX-HEAPIFY() we can construct a max-heap by starting with the last node that has children (which occurs at A.length/2 the elements the … i have an apple iphone 8 need to be unlockedWebWe use logical operators to check whether an expression is true or false. If the expression is true, it returns 1 whereas if the expression is false, it returns 0. Assume variable A holds … is the iphone unlockedWeb14 jul. 2024 · Starting with a complete binary tree, the heap can be transformed into a Max-Heap by using the function "heapify" on all of its non-leaf components. The heapify … i have an appointment with dentistWebHeapify essentially loops through the entire tree making sure each tree and subtree are valid heaps. This is a max-heap: 6 / \ 4 5 / \ 2 1 *Note: min-heap is merely the reverse of … is the iphone x a 5g phoneWeb19 jun. 2024 · Min Binary Heap or Min Heap where the parent node is smaller than its children nodes. The main () function of Heap Sort is to call the heapify () function which … i have an associate\u0027s degree now whatWeb72K views 2 years ago INDIA This video explains a very important heap algorithm which is the heapify algorithm.We can apply max heapify on a max heap and min heapify on a … is the iphone x 4g